
Will team principal role blunt Newey's technical powers?
About this episode
On the latest edition of The Race F1 Tech Show, Edd Straw and Gary Anderson discuss whether Adrian Newey's impending switch to the team principal role at Aston Martin will blunt the impact he'll be able to make on the technical side of things at the team.
Before that, Gary has his say on McLaren's baffling Qatar strategy, and he also discusses why teams are having to 'make do and mend' with car parts at this late stage of the season.
As ever, Gary also gets stuck into answering questions from listeners, which this week are on tyre graining, plank skids, and Oscar Piastri's low-grip struggles.
